By Therese Lisieux on February 11th, 2009Jonathan Lebed was 15 in September 1999 when he started buying stocks using accounts at AOL and E*Trade. Lebed used fake names to post messages in Yahoo Finance message boards to recommend the stocks he bought to other readers.
Trading soared from their normal 60,000 daily to more than a million. Lebed sold his stocks and made money. Readers never really questioned the wisdom of the poster/s of messages. They read, they bought, and Lebed made money when he sold his stocks to them. The US SEC made many allegations against Lebed but later settled with Lebed.
